Discharge PlannerCrisis Center
Full-time (12 hour shifts) 7p-7a
Must be able to work well with clients with multiple problems.
Must possess strong communication skills and the ability to coordinate with
Indian Rivers Behavioral Health programs and various other community resources
Must be knowledgeable of serious mental illness and substance use disorder
diagnoses, symptoms, and treatments.
Must be knowledgeable of the various services provided by multiple community
agencies and methods for making referrals to those agencies.
Must be able to comprehend and maintain program standards.
Must possess excellent professional verbal and written communication skills.
Must be able to interact with clients and their families in a respectful and
sensitive manner.
Must be able to work within the Organization to effectively serve the needs
of the consumers.
Must be able to work with other program staff in a cooperative, supportive
manner.
Must be knowledgeable in cultural diversity.
Must possess competent computer skills.
Work cohesively with a multi-disciplinary treatment team to assess and
formalize discharge plans for each client.
Assess clients' needs in all life domains necessary to successful
recovery/discharge plans.
Cultivate a working knowledge of all relevant community resources.
Communicate effectively with outside agencies regarding clients' needs.
Provide for follow-up to discharged clients to ensure engagement in
aftercare services.
Ensure all safety, fire prevention, and health measures are followed while
on duty.
Work in conjunction with paraprofessionals and professional staff.
Establish and maintain therapeutic relationships, observing professional
boundaries.
Assist consumers through crisis situations and/or arrange for the provision
of such assistance from other professionals/personal care givers.
Follow the DMH/DD and Medicaid standards for provision of case management,
crisis intervention, basic living skills, and family support services.
Provide assessment and referral to necessary and appropriate referral
sources.
Ensure client charts are up to date and accurate.
Attend staffing and team meetings as assigned.
Ensure safety of consumers, preserving basic human and legal rights.
Demonstrate appropriate and ethical behavior at all times.
Demonstrate a positive attitude toward work and the completion of work
assignments.
Address any consumer concerns to the Supervisor or Program Manager.
Provide all necessary data as required by the center and the state.
